Robots with AGV technology for visual navigation include housing, chassis, main controller, memory, bottom-level control unit, power management unit and motor drive module, as well as sensor unit.The sensor unit includes lidar module, inertial navigation module, ultrasonic sensor, The depth camera and visual sensor, the sensor unit is connected to the bottom control unit, the bottom control unit is connected to the input terminal of the main controller, the bottom control unit is also connected to the touch screen, the touch screen is provided on the side of the shell, the shell and the chassis together form a control room, control There is a main controller, memory, bottom control unit, power management unit and motor drive module in the room. The main controller is connected to the memory, the main controller is connected to the power supply through the power management unit, and the main controller is connected to the motor through the motor drive module; Robots with AGV technology for visual navigation have better environmental perception and autonomous action capabilities, and use trackless navigation without the need to transform the original environment.

The robot housing of the visual navigation AGV technology is provided on the chassis.The chassis includes axles, wheels and a chassis.The chassis has a through hole for the axle to pass through.There are bearings between the chassis and the axle. The axle is driven by a motor. The motor is located on the chassis. It is characterized by a sensor unit, which includes a lidar module, an inertial navigation module, an ultrasonic sensor, a depth camera, and a visual sensor. The sensor unit is connected to the bottom control unit. The control unit is connected to the input of the main controller, the bottom control unit is also connected to the touch screen, the touch screen is located on the side of the housing, the housing and the chassis together form a control room, the control room is equipped with the main controller, memory, bottom control unit, power supply The management unit and the motor drive module, the main controller is connected to the memory, the main controller is connected to the power through the power management unit, and the main controller is connected to the motor through the motor drive module.
